Output 8e418952e06399e338a3c8b241c984285f699daa035db20d25e0efb5a821b87f:0

value
41842593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a4ea1e2f444e78cb6b78f23c72e4e4af55f875 OP_EQUAL
address
3CWMDeAtZ9Xki5yNn4YB987JoSiuthrfCv
transaction
8e418952e06399e338a3c8b241c984285f699daa035db20d25e0efb5a821b87f
spent
true